Job Description

• Excellent communication and collaboration skills with demonstrated ability to work across various levels of an organization and problem solving skills
• Expert knowledge of server, networking, operating system, database, application performance management, monitoring and alerting system, load balancing, and security systems
• Strong Linux and Windows administrative capabilities
• Expert working knowledge of DevOps and cloud operational support processes
• Experience designing, implementing, and maintaining monitoring and metrics systems
• Experience with scripting languages
• Experience with provisioning software like Ansible or similar tools.
• Experience with source control like Git
• Experience with Docker, and container orchestration software
• Experience with monitoring tools like Prometheus, Nagios or similar tools
• Experience with Jira processes a plus

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
